Small module SINGLE core ARM Cortex-A8 up to 1000 MHz
The IGEP COM MODULE is an industrial processor board. It can be used as a computer-on-module for your product. The IGEP COM MODULE provides a lot of features in a small size. You can build your project anywhere you want.
Features | |
---|---|
Processor |
DM3730 / AM3703, by Texas Instruments |
3D/2D Accelerator | PowerVR SGX GPU, providing graphics acceleration with OpenGL ES1.0, OpenGL ES2.0 and OpenVG support (Only in DM3730 version) |
Video |
Video acceleration: H.264, H.263, MPEG-4, MPEG-2, JPEG, WMV9 and additional codecs. Video encoder/decoder up to 720p (Only in DM3730 version) |
Memory | RAM: Up to 512 MB Mobile DDR (Standard setup 512 MB) Flash: Up to 512 MB (Standard setup 512 MB) Onboard micro-SD card socket |
Ethernet |
No |
USB |
1 x USB 2.0 Host (connector not included) |
Display |
1 x Digital Video/TFT interface |
Image Capture Interface | 1 x CPI interface (12 bits) |
Wireless |
WiFi IEEE 802.11 b/g/n (Access Point: Yes) |
Antenna |
1 x Internal WiFi/Bluetooth antenna |
Additional Interfaces
|
4 x UART |
SW Support | Linux Android |
Power Supply | Power from expansion connectors: From 3,5 V to 4,2 V Digital I/O voltage: 1,8 V |
Power Consumption | Typical 1 W (depending on software) Maximum 2 W (depending on software) |
Thermal | Commercial temperature: 0 ºC to +60 ºC Industrial temperature: -40 ºC to +85 ºC |
Form Factor | 18 mm x 68.5 mm Gumstix compatible |
Humidity | 93% relative Humidity at 40 ºC, non-condensing (according to IEC 60068-2-78) |
MTBF | > 100000 hours |
